Glosario

Algunos términos que podrían usarse en esta descripción incluyen:

Shelfwear
Minor wear resulting from a book being place on, and taken from a bookshelf, especially along the bottom edge.
Gutter
The inside margin of a book, connecting the pages to the joints near the binding.
